Why zero-cost samples still convert

Samples lower friction to trial and create a path to subscription. However, mismanaged sample programs can create cost blowouts and legal headaches. Use this practical guide to stay efficient and compliant.

Edge-tech and tracking

  • Edge-cached signup pages for instant confirmation;
  • Lightweight telemetry to measure sample arrival and first usage;
  • Return credits to incentivise reusable packaging recovery.

Case study

A cosmetics brand ran a zero-cost sample drop integrated with local pop-ups and micro-hubs. They achieved a 10% conversion to first purchase and used return credits to recover 60% of reusable packaging.

Final checklist

  • Legal terms and escalation templates in place;
  • Predictive micro-hub partners identified;
  • Edge-cached signup and tracking enabled;
  • Clear reuse/return incentives for packaging.

Bottom line: Zero-cost sample drops can be efficient if you pair them with predictable fulfilment, legal clarity, and edge-first signups. Build repeatable ops and measure the true cost per converted customer.
